Will Jains Eat Non Veg . Jains do not consume foods that involve harming other organisms, in other words, they do not eat meat, eggs, and root vegetables (essentially because they believe killing the roots is taking life). However, they may have dairy products such as milk and cheese, and they can also have a variety of fruits and vegetables.
